Output 16dc79baaaef2ea566150e77fce30aa1aba7eb841a79bcd8100c30fe69ad3790:67

value
59022787
script pubkey
OP_0 OP_PUSHBYTES_32 3b626c64f1d5bbdc0a235bc4f5df071fd83114bf592f07a9c3b061aa2bbf54a9
address
bc1q8d3xce836kaacz3rt0z0thc8rlvrz99ltyhs02wrkps652al2j5swsxqm6
transaction
16dc79baaaef2ea566150e77fce30aa1aba7eb841a79bcd8100c30fe69ad3790
spent
true